Field Notes

Description:

80 - 90cm length, over 120cm wingspan, black color with yellow throat-patch, weight 1,5 up to 5kg, lifespan up to 8 years. Eats fish, and sometimes rats. Dives very well.

Habitat:

Coasts, estuaries, deltas, large bodies of water. In the warm winters stays, and in cold winters migrates south. Nests in colonies sometimes in mixture with pelicans. 3 - 4 eggs, babies hatches in 28 - 30 days, and they stay in the nest around 7 weeks.
This one is from a group of 5, that stayed for several days in the center of the city where they could find a small part of the river that was not frozen.
